采用加入0.5%4-F苄基取代吲哚嗪衍生物作为缓蚀剂在90℃、20 wt.%盐酸中的失重评价数据来研究其在盐酸中的吸附行为。吸附热力学是通过研究缓蚀剂的浓度C与浓度和覆盖度比值(C/θ)之间的关系曲线,并对得到的关系曲线进行拟合,确认最符合的等温吸附模型来计算相关的吸附热力学参数。
